"The result and content are both the responsibility of the coach."
Seoul E-Land suffered a 1-3 comeback defeat against Bucheon FC in the Hana Bank K League 2 2025 Round 16 at Bucheon Sports Complex on the 14th.
With this defeat, E-Land remained in 4th place with 8 wins, 4 draws, and 4 losses, totaling 28 points.
E-Land's coach Kim Do-kyun expressed after the match, "I sincerely apologize to the fans who came all the way to the away game. It was an embarrassing match. There's nothing I can say except for that I'm sorry," adding, "The result and content are both the responsibility of the coach. The areas where we were not properly prepared have emerged, and it showed in the results. The coach must take responsibility. Rather than focusing on the mistakes that led to the goals we've conceded, the overall performance was not good. It was a game that made me think, 'Is this the football we are pursuing?' We need to create situations to control the overall game. We need to deeply consider game management and shape. This defeat should not cause the team to stagnate."
Regarding the comeback goal and the additional goal situation, Coach Kim explained, "Clearly, there were mistakes. I was not well prepared, and the players just followed. Even though we play football while considering the risks during buildup situations, it was a scene that should not have happened. Concentration is an issue, but I do not intend to blame anyone. I will prepare well to ensure that mistakes do not recur next time."
Coach Kim Do-kyun remarked, "Losing the ball too easily leads to physical difficulties. After 30 minutes in the first half, our stamina dropped, and overall changes were needed, but there were many difficulties. We should have maintained consistency throughout the 45 minutes. There were difficulties due to that impact."
